While the 2025 NFL schedule won't be released until May 14, we do know the matchups and where they will take place, and fans have already begun to circle certain matchups as the ones to watch.

NFL.com's Kevin Patra noted 10 must-watch matchups, of which the Kansas City Chiefs have three games on the list, including the top spot.

The top selection should be no surprise, as the Chiefs will travel to Buffalo to take on the Bills.

"Josh Allen and Patrick Mahomes make for appointment viewing on their own -- when they are on the same gridiron, it's a must-watch live situation. Buffalo and Kansas City have faced off nine times since 2020, and while the Bills have won four straight regular-season clashes, they have yet to get over the postseason hump against Mahomes and Co,'' wrote Patra.

A Super Bowl rematch claims the No. 4 spot on the list, as the Chiefs host the Philadelphia Eagles.

"The Super Bowl rematch might have been a dud, but that doesn't mean this game will follow suit,'' he wrote. "The Eagles blasted Kansas City with a dominating front in February, and Jalen Hurts dive-bombed the Chiefs defense. ... The matchup will show how far each squad has come since the Super Bowl. In the four matchups between the Eagles and Chiefs during the Hurts era, Kansas City won the first two and Philly won the last two. As if this bout needed more fire, there is also the backdrop of Eagles coach Nick Sirianni yelling at Chiefs fans the last time his club visited GEHA Field at Arrowhead Stadium,'' noted Patra.

Perhaps a not-so-obvious one rounds out the Chiefs' matchups with the No. 7 spot, but fans from all over will be tuned in to Patrick Mahomes vs. Lamar Jackson, as the Chiefs host the Baltimore Ravens.

"I know I'm recycling teams, but I couldn't leave Lamar Jackson versus Patrick Mahomes on the cutting room floor,'' he wrote. "Mahomes and Jackson account for four of the past seven NFL MVP awards. Their matchups are, by default, appointment viewing."
